What exactly the problem?

Unable to Establish Connection to the Game error in Helldivers 2

Helldivers 2 players sometimes encounter an “Unable to Establish Connection to the Game” error. This message prevents them from progressing past the initial loading screen or accessing any part of the game, including tutorials.

The error typically points to network-related issues. There are two main culprits:

  • Server Problems: Occasionally, the Helldivers 2 servers themselves might be experiencing technical difficulties or be overloaded, hindering player connections.
  • nProtect GameGuard Glitch: The nProtect GameGuard anti-cheat system, designed to maintain a fair gameplay environment, can sometimes malfunction and block your connection unintentionally.

Often, simply resetting your network connection can resolve issues with GameGuard and get you back to gaming!

How to Fix Unable to Establish Connection in Helldivers 2

There are basically two ways you can solve error establishing connection error in this game: First is by doing network reset and second is by using OpenDNS.

When you perform the network reset it will fix any temporary glitch between you network and gaming server.

This is simple and Ideal solution if you did get error only one time.

However, even after network reset you are getting same error again and again you can use the Open DNS method instead.

Here is both of these methods:

Method 1: The Network Reset

  1. Search for “cmd” in your Windows search bar. Right-click on “Command Prompt” and select “Run as Administrator”.
  2. Enter the following commands, pressing Enter after each one:
    • netsh winsock reset
    • netsh int ip reset all
    • netsh winhttp reset proxy
    • ipconfig /flushdns
  3. Restart your computer and try connecting to Helldivers 2 again.

Method 2: Using the Open DNS

In this method, you need to change your DNS to Open DNS to avoid any connection issues with Helldivers 2 in the future. Here is how you can change the DNS to Open DNS on your Windows PC:

  1. Right-click on the network icon in your taskbar and choose “Open Network & Internet Settings.”
  2. Click on “Change adapter options.”
  3. Right-click on your active network connection (like Wi-Fi) and select “Properties.”
  4. Double-click on “Internet Protocol Version 4 (TCP/IPv4).”
  5. Select “Use the following DNS server addresses” and enter:
    • Preferred DNS server: 208.67.222.222
    • Alternate DNS server: 208.67.220.220
  6. Click “OK” twice.
  7. Search for “cmd,” open Command Prompt, and type ipconfig /flushdns.
  8. Restart your computer and then Helldivers 2 again.

Still, Battling the Bug? Try These Other Tactics!

While the troubleshooting mentioned above will frequently work and solve the problem, the issue may emerge for a variety of additional causes, including:

  • Server status check: Check the official Helldivers 2 website, Twitter, or community forums for any known server difficulties or maintenance periods. It makes no sense to fix something that isn’t broken on your end!
  • Firewall issues Sometimes your firewall can be overly protective. Disable it temporarily and try to connect to Helldivers 2. Just remember to switch it back on for safety!
  • Antivirus interference: Your antivirus program may be identifying the game as a false positive. Disable it temporarily to see if it makes an impact. Do not forget to re-enable it afterward!
